Инструкция по созданию ipa файла приложения на iPhone.


Разработка приложений для iPhone может быть достаточно сложным и трудоемким процессом. Однако, когда ваше приложение готово к выходу в свет, вам необходимо сделать его ipa файл для загрузки на устройства iPhone и iPad. В этой статье мы расскажем вам, как правильно создать ipa файл для вашего приложения.

Создание ipa файла — это последний этап в разработке вашего приложения. Ipa файл — это архив с приложением, который содержит все необходимые файлы и данные для его работы на устройствах iPhone и iPad. Чтобы создать ipa файл, вы должны иметь подписку на Apple Developer Program и иметь доступ к своему аккаунту разработчика на портале Apple Developer.

Первым шагом для создания ipa файла является установка необходимых инструментов разработки iOS, таких как Xcode. Xcode является интегрированной средой разработки, которая содержит все необходимые инструменты и библиотеки для создания приложений для iPhone и iPad. После установки Xcode вы можете открыть ваш проект приложения и выбрать опцию «Archive» в меню «Product».

После завершения процесса архивации, Xcode создаст ipa файл вашего приложения и сохранит его в указанном вами месте на вашем компьютере. Вы можете использовать этот ipa файл для загрузки вашего приложения на устройства iPhone и iPad или для публикации его в App Store.

Создание ipa-файла для iPhone-приложения

Чтобы создать ipa-файл для iPhone-приложения, необходимо следовать определенной последовательности действий:

  1. Открыть Xcode, интегрированную среду разработки приложений для устройств Apple.
  2. Убедиться, что выбранный проект полностью готов к сборке и установке на устройство.
  3. Выбрать целевое устройство для сборки ipa-файла и установки приложения.
  4. Настройка параметров сборки, таких как подпись и кодирование.
  5. Провести сборку приложения, чтобы получить бинарный код и ресурсы.
  6. Проверить бинарный код и ресурсы на наличие ошибок или проблем.
  7. Создать ipa-файл, объединяющий бинарный код и ресурсы в одном архиве.
  8. Проверить полученный ipa-файл на наличие ошибок.
  9. Установить ipa-файл на выбранное устройство iPhone.

Убедитесь, что каждый из вышеперечисленных шагов выполнен правильно, чтобы избежать возможных проблем при установке и запуске приложения на iPhone.

Важно отметить, что создание ipa-файла возможно только при наличии необходимых сертификатов и профилей разработчика. Без них не удастся подписать приложение и установить его на устройство iPhone.

Создание ipa-файла — важный шаг в процессе разработки iPhone-приложений. Это позволяет разработчикам проверить функциональность и соответствие приложения требованиям перед его публикацией в App Store.

Установка необходимых инструментов

Перед тем как начать собирать ipa файл для вашего приложения на iPhone, вам понадобится установить несколько важных инструментов:

Xcode: Xcode — это интегрированная среда разработки (IDE), разработанная Apple, которая включает в себя все необходимые инструменты для создания приложений для iPhone. Вы можете скачать и установить Xcode бесплатно с официального сайта разработчиков Apple.

Apple Developer Program: Чтобы создать ipa файл для iPhone, вам нужно будет зарегистрироваться в Apple Developer Program. Эта платформа предоставляет доступ к инструментам и ресурсам, необходимым для создания, тестирования и распространения приложений для iPhone.

Provisioning profile: Профиль предоставления — это файл, который определяет, какие устройства разрешено использовать для тестирования и развертывания вашего приложения на iPhone. Вы должны создать и скачать Provisioning profile из своей учетной записи разработчика Apple Developer Program.

Сертификат разработчика: Сертификат разработчика — это файл, подтверждающий вашу легитимность как разработчика и позволяющий вам создавать и подписывать приложения для iPhone. Вы должны создать и скачать свой сертификат разработчика из своей учетной записи разработчика Apple Developer Program.

После установки и настройки этих инструментов вы будете готовы к созданию ipa файла для вашего приложения на iPhone.

Получение учетных данных для разработчика

Для того чтобы создавать, подписывать и устанавливать ipa файлы приложений на iPhone из своего аккаунта разработчика, вам понадобятся определенные учетные данные. Вот список необходимых данных:

1. Apple ID — это уникальное имя пользователя, которое вы используете для входа в ваш аккаунт разработчика на Apple Developer. Если у вас еще нет Apple ID, вы можете его создать на официальном сайте компании.

2. Apple Developer Program — это платная подписка, которая дает вам полный доступ к разработческим инструментам и ресурсам Apple. Чтобы стать членом программы, вам нужно будет заплатить ежегодную плату.

3. Сертификат разработчика — это файл, который подтверждает вашу легитимность в качестве разработчика. Чтобы создать сертификат, вам потребуется сгенерировать и сохранить certificate signing request (CSR) на вашем Mac, а затем следовать инструкциям на сайте Apple Developer для создания сертификата.

4. Профиль проекта — это файл, который содержит информацию о вашем проекте, включая Bundle Identifier и учетные данные для подписи приложения. Чтобы создать профиль проекта, вам нужно будет зарегистрировать Bundle Identifier, создать App ID и добавить ваше устройство или симулятор в список разрешенных для разработки.

Учитывая вышеперечисленные данные, вы сможете без проблем создавать и устанавливать ipa файлы приложений на ваших устройствах iPhone.

Настройка проекта в Xcode

Для создания ipa файла приложения на iPhone необходимо настроить проект в среде разработки Xcode. В этом разделе рассмотрим основные шаги настройки проекта.

1. Откройте Xcode и создайте новый проект. Выберите шаблон приложения, который соответствует типу вашего проекта.

2. Укажите имя проекта и выберите директорию, в которой будет создан проект.

3. Проверьте целевую платформу вашего проекта. Для создания ipa файла для iPhone выберите iOS в качестве целевой платформы.

4. Укажите Bundle Identifier для вашего проекта. Bundle Identifier должен быть уникальным и соответствовать правилам именования.

5. Зарегистрируйте ваше устройство для разработки. Подключите ваш iPhone к компьютеру и в Xcode выберите его в качестве целевого устройства.

6. Проверьте настройки версии iOS и выберите необходимую минимальную версию. Обратите внимание, что некоторые функции могут быть недоступны на старых версиях iOS.

7. Настройте подпись и сертификаты. Для создания ipa файла вам потребуется действительный разработческий сертификат и соответствующий приватный ключ. Установите их в Xcode и выберите их в настройках проекта.

8. Проверьте настройки сборки проекта, такие как архитектура и режим сборки. Убедитесь, что все параметры настроены правильно.

9. После завершения настройки проекта вы можете собрать его в ipa файл. Для этого выберите Product -> Archive из меню Xcode и следуйте инструкциям.

Теперь вы знаете, как настроить проект в Xcode для создания ipa файла приложения на iPhone. Следуйте этим шагам и вы сможете успешно собрать ваше приложение и распространять его на устройства iOS.

Сборка и экспорт ipa-файла

Для того чтобы создать ipa-файл вашего приложения на iPhone, следуйте следующим шагам:

1. Запустите Xcode и откройте ваш проект.

2. В меню выберите «Product» и затем «Archive».

3. Xcode начнет собирать ваше приложение. Этот шаг может занять некоторое время.

4. После завершения сборки, откроется панель «Archives». Здесь вы увидите список всех ранее созданных архивов.

5. Выберите последний архив и нажмите на кнопку «Export».

6. В открывшемся окне выберите опцию «iOS App Store», чтобы создать ipa-файл для публикации в App Store.

7. В следующих окнах вам будут предложены различные конфигурации и настройки экспорта. Выберите необходимые настройки и нажмите кнопку «Next».

8. Затем укажите место, куда вы хотите сохранить ipa-файл, и нажмите кнопку «Export».

9. После этого Xcode создаст ipa-файл вашего приложения, который можно использовать для установки на iPhone или передачи другим пользователям.

Теперь у вас есть ipa-файл вашего приложения на iPhone, готовый для развертывания и использования!

Подписание ipa-файла

Для подписания ipa-файла вам понадобится сертификат разработчика, закрытый ключ и профиль устройства. Сертификат разработчика получается от Apple Developer Program, а профиль устройства создается в Developer Center.

После того как у вас есть все необходимые компоненты, вы можете начать процесс подписания ipa-файла.

ШагОписание
1Откройте Terminal на вашем Mac.
2Перейдите в каталог, где находится ваш ipa-файл. Используйте команду cd, чтобы перейти в нужную папку.
3Выполните следующую команду, чтобы подписать ipa-файл:
codesign -f -s "имя_сертификата" "имя_файла.ipa"
4Введите ваш пароль Mac, когда вас попросят.
5Подписанный ipa-файл будет создан в той же папке, где находится ваш исходный ipa-файл.

Теперь у вас есть подписанный ipa-файл, который можно использовать для установки приложения на устройства iPhone через iTunes или другие инструменты для управления устройствами.

Убедитесь, что вы сохраняете свои сертификаты и закрытые ключи в безопасности. Они являются важными компонентами, необходимыми для подписания ipa-файлов и обновления ваших приложений на устройствах.

Тестирование и распространение ipa-файла

После создания ipa-файла, приложение нужно протестировать перед его распространением. Тестирование поможет обнаружить и исправить возможные ошибки и проблемы, а также убедиться в правильной работе приложения.

Для тестирования ipa-файла вы можете использовать различные инструменты и методы. Один из способов — установить ipa-файл на устройство и протестировать его локально. Для этого вам потребуется связаться с разработчиком или получить доступ к ipa-файлу.

Если вы хотите протестировать ipa-файл на реальном устройстве, вам потребуется установить его на iPhone через iTunes или Xcode. Для этого вам нужно подключить iPhone к компьютеру, открыть iTunes или Xcode, выбрать устройство и установить ipa-файл.

Также вы можете использовать инструменты для автоматического тестирования, такие как XCTest или Appium. Они позволяют автоматизировать процесс тестирования приложений и обнаружить ошибки и проблемы.

После успешного тестирования ipa-файла вы готовы к его распространению. Существует несколько способов распространения ipa-файла, включая публикацию на App Store или использование инструментов для OTA-установки (Over-The-Air).

Публикация на App Store является наиболее распространенным способом распространения ipa-файла. Для этого вам потребуется зарегистрироваться в качестве разработчика Apple, создать профиль приложения, загрузить ipa-файл на App Store Connect и пройти процесс рецензии.

Если вы хотите распространить ipa-файл через OTA-установку, вам потребуется несколько дополнительных шагов. Вы должны настроить сервер для хранения ipa-файла и создать plist-файл, который будет содержать информацию о версии и url-адресе ipa-файла. Затем вы сможете распространять ipa-файл, отправив ссылку пользователям, которые могут установить его на свои устройства.

Тестирование и распространение ipa-файла являются важными шагами при разработке и распространении приложения на iPhone. Не забывайте уделить им достаточно внимания, чтобы обеспечить качество и удобство использования вашего приложения.

Добавить комментарий

Вам также может понравиться